Key Skills to Look For
Technical skills
Proficiency in property management systems such as Opera, IDS, and Cloudbeds, along with strong MS Office and CRM software knowledge.
Diverse portfolio
Experience in managing guest relations, handling front desk operations, and coordinating with housekeeping and maintenance teams across various properties.
Soft skills
Excellent communication, leadership, and problem-solving abilities, with a focus on guest satisfaction and conflict resolution.
Relevant sector experience
Background in hospitality, corporate offices, or luxury service environments prevalent in Mumbai’s business districts like Bandra Kurla Complex and Nariman Point.
Screening & Interviewing Process
Portfolio evaluation
Review previous employment history, guest feedback scores, and examples of operational improvements implemented.
Interview formats
Use both video and in-person interviews to assess interpersonal skills, professionalism, and situational judgment.
Sample interview questions for Front Office Manager
- How do you handle guest complaints under pressure?
- What strategies do you use to enhance guest satisfaction scores?
- Describe how you manage scheduling and staff motivation.
Technical tests or trials
Assign a short role-play scenario or a simulated customer-handling task to measure practical ability and composure.
References
Request feedback from previous employers or clients in Mumbai’s hospitality sector to confirm reliability and service quality.

What skills should a Front Office Manager in Mumbai have?
A Front Office Manager in Mumbai should have experience with PMS tools like Opera, strong communication skills, leadership qualities, and the ability to manage multicultural teams efficiently.
How much does it cost to hire a Front Office Manager in Mumbai?
Salaries vary depending on experience and property size, typically ranging from INR 4 to 10 lakhs annually for mid to senior-level professionals.
